Frequency converter connection (3Phase units)

About this task
Important: This connection must be carried out by qualified electrical personnel.
Before carrying out any connection, check that the upstream protection devices
(Normal AC source and Bypass AC source) are open "O" (off).
Always connect the ground wire first.

1. Remove the jumper.
2. Insert the Normal AC cable through the
cable gland.
3. Connect the five cables (for 8PX and 9PX
models) or three cables (for KX models)
to the Normal AC source terminal blocks.
Do not connect anything to the Bypass
terminal blocks.
4. Insert the Output cable through the cable
gland.
5. Connect the three cables to the Output
terminal blocks.
6. Put back and secure the terminal blocks
cover with the screws.
7. Tighten the cable glands.
